aero | air |
aerobics | exercise that increases the need for oxygen |
aerodynamics | the study of how air and gases flow |
aeronautics | n. the art or practice of flying aircraft |
aesthet | sense, perception |
aethetics | Study of beauty and art in nature |
aesthetically | adv. with regard to aesthetics, with regard to the perception and appreciation of beauty; with a refined sense of taste |
aesthete | one who professes great sensitivity to the beauty of art and nature |
ag | Move, do |
agent | a person who acts or does business for another |
agency | an organization, company, or bureau that provides some service for another |
agi | move, do |
agile | moving quickly and lightly |
agitate | stir up; disturb |
agitation | the act of agitating something |
agitator | (n) a person who stirs up others in order to upset the status quo and further a political, social, or other cause |
agogue | leader |
demagogue | an orator who appeals to the passions and prejudices of his audience |
pedagogue | a schoolteacher |
agronomy | the science of soil management and production of field crops |
agrobiology | study of plant nutrition; soil yields |
agronomics | study of productivity of land |
agri | farming |
agribusiness | farm related business such as crops and livestock |
agrichemical | any chemical used for farming |
agriculture | the practice of cultivating the land or raising stock |
agron | struggling |
agony | intense feelings of suffering |
antagonize | to annoy or provoke to anger |
protagonist | the principal character in a work of fiction |
antagonist | the character who works against the protagonist in the story |
